## **1. Understanding the NRX+ Series**
The **G. Loomis NRX+** series represents the pinnacle of fly rod engineering, combining cutting-edge materials with expert craftsmanship. The **NRX+ 9’5″ LP (Light Presentation) 4pc** is specifically designed for delicate presentations, making it ideal for trout, grayling, and other freshwater species that demand finesse.
### **Key Features:**
– **Length & Action:** At **9 feet 5 inches**, this rod offers a perfect balance between reach and control. The **LP (Light Presentation) taper** provides a medium-fast action, allowing for smooth, accurate casts while maintaining sensitivity for detecting subtle strikes.
– **4-Piece Construction:** The 4-piece design enhances portability without sacrificing performance, making it a great travel companion.
– **Advanced Blank Technology:** Built with **G. Loomis’ proprietary Nano Silica Resin System (NRX+)**, the rod is incredibly lightweight yet powerful, offering superior energy transfer and responsiveness.
## **2. Who Should Use the NRX+ 9’5″ LP?**
This rod is best suited for anglers who:
– **Fish in technical waters** where delicate presentations are crucial (e.g., spring creeks, tailwaters, or pressured trout streams).
– **Prefer dry flies, nymphs, or small streamers**—the LP taper excels at laying down soft, drag-free drifts.
– **Want a high-performance rod** that balances finesse and power for both short and medium-range casts.
## **3. Choosing the Right Line Weight**
The **NRX+ 9’5″ LP** is typically rated for a **4 or 5-weight line**, depending on your fishing style:
– **4-weight:** Best for ultra-delicate presentations on small streams or when targeting spooky fish.
– **5-weight:** Offers more versatility, allowing you to handle slightly larger flies and windy conditions.
Pairing it with a **high-quality floating line** (like the **RIO Gold or Scientific Anglers Amplitude Smooth**) will maximize its performance.
